SNL-Delft3D-FM Validation and Case Study: CEC Array at Tanana River Test Site
These dataset support the validation and case study efforts for the SNL-Delft3D-FM program:
1) Set 1: Simulations of a single turbine in a flume under conditions conducted by Mycek (2014) with and with turbulent parameter correction. These simulations also include cases using various grid types including rectangular, triangular, and hybrid (Casulli).
2) Set 2: Simulations of two turbines in tandem in a flume under conditions conducted by Mycek (2014) with and with turbulent parameter correction.
3) Set 3: Simulation of the Tanana River Test Site with and without the turbine array.
All cases include both the setup files and the numerical output data (NetCFD format).
